Level Two Workshops
Narrative Storytelling
Momenta's Level Two workshops are a combination of the very best instructors the industry has to offer matched with the most beautiful, vibrant, and relevant locations we can find. This is, simply, the most complete and intensive mid-level workshop available anywhere.
- The high-intensity pace of these workshops are reflective of the goal for every client. We aim for students produce a high-quality professional photo narrative by trip's end.
- These workshops are particularly applicable to aspiring or citizen journalists who aim to use their equipment to communicate. Even experienced visual professionals benefit from the high level of instruction and regular editing that are the main component of these programs.
- Multimedia instruction is an option for every Level Two workshop to better enhance the storytelling skills of clients.
- Level Two workshops develop skills in: advanced available light and night photography, use of supplemental lighting and multi-unit flash systems, advanced story packaging, seeing the "Decisive Moment", using assistants and fixers in the field and many more advanced techniques to explore photography at a professional level.
